History and Overview

Virginia City

Before the hue and cry of "silver" on the Comstock brought miners here, Nevada was just a stopover for pioneers on their way to California. With the arrival of settlers, the church was not far behind. Methodist missionaries were among the first trailblazers.

In the winter of 1868 the town site of Reno was established and in the spring the first meeting of this church took place. Our first building was built in 1870 - yes, what has become Reno First United Methodist Church is the oldest church in Reno. In 1926 the cornerstone of the present church was laid.
